Output e25bb905e544462dfb31123833ffe251b2731660a6e92f0780301cb69a511053:42

value
3326
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d4aeb81519a98b12907675c8a0ba977761971b7b OP_EQUAL
address
3M5aUuVBZmuYoaC8KjSK5wF3DHrMCTZSjb
transaction
e25bb905e544462dfb31123833ffe251b2731660a6e92f0780301cb69a511053
spent
true